What is Prague Castle?

Prague Castle is a complex of buildings that covers an area of about 70,000 square meters. It was founded in the 9th century as a wooden fortress and has since then undergone several renovations and expansions. The castle complex houses several palaces, churches, gardens, and courtyards.

Why is Prague Castle so Popular?

Even though it’s not the biggest castle in the world, Prague Castle still holds immense popularity among tourists. This could be attributed to its rich history and stunning architecture. Some notable buildings within the castle complex include:

  • The St. Vitus Cathedral: This is the most prominent building in the entire complex. It is a stunning example of Gothic architecture and took almost 600 years to complete.
  • The Old Royal Palace: This palace was once the seat of power for Czech rulers and now houses several art exhibitions and concerts.
  • The Golden Lane: This picturesque alleyway is lined with tiny, colorful houses that were once inhabited by goldsmiths.
